Living in Tiong Bahru means embracing one of Singapore’s most vibrant and sought after neighbourhoods. Start your mornings at the famous Tiong Bahru Market, enjoy brunch along Yong Siak Street, discover independent cafés and boutiques, or simply take an evening stroll beneath the mature rain trees that give this conservation estate its unmistakable charm.

Conveniently located near Tiong Bahru MRT and Havelock MRT, you’ll also enjoy easy access to Great World City, Outram Park, Singapore General Hospital, Robertson Quay, River Valley, Orchard Road, Marina Bay and the CBD.
